“Kitchen” – Dance Theatrical performance

The Bulgarian Cultural Institute presents “Kitchen” an author’s dance-theater performance that crosses traditional boundaries and touches the audience through an alternative culinary experience on a non-traditional stage:

“Kitchen” recreates the glowing atmosphere and dynamics in the professional kitchen through the prism of “immersive” theater (immersive – immersion), which allows the audience to immerse themselves in the action and experience the extreme situations that usually remain hidden from people.

The love for art brings together the choreographer Kosta Karakashyan and the director and playwright Antonia Georgieva in partnership with the master confectioner Alexander Tsekov, creative director of the restaurant “Cosmos”, who together decide to take interesting horizons in this difficult time for art.

The paths of Costa and Antonia do not meet for the first time. After successfully making the short film “WAITING FOR COLOR”, which won the Lumiere Prize at the Cinédanse Festival, fate brought them together again for this unusual project.

Together with Alexander, the challenge for something new and different in the kitchen includes Alexandra Talyokova, Iskra Daskalova, Krastyo Metodiev and Yanitsa Stankeva – four prominent dancers in the aesthetics of contemporary dance, break and waking. The non-traditional stage space is separated from the artistic view of the set designer Boris Dalchev and the composer and music engineer Georgi Atanasov.

This is the first of such experimental projects of this creative team, created for alternative spaces, which aim to present the performing arts in a different light and to develop and promote the immersive genre in Bulgaria. The project is implemented with the support of the National Culture Fund and HRC Culinary Academy.
